What does HACCP mean
Ivenika [448]
HACCP stands for:

Hazard
Analysis
Critical
Control
Point
<span>HACCP is a management system in which food safety is addressed through the analysis and control of biological, chemical, and physical hazards from raw material production, procurement and handling, to manufacturing, distribution and consumption of the finished product. Which title of a book is handwritten correctly?
Darya [45]
The correct way to HANDWRITE the title would be:

<u>Miss Pickerell Goes to Mars</u>

You would have to underline it handwritten, but, if you were on a computer, you would italicizes it.
